一种基于MOCCC-II多功能滤波器

摘    要:本文提出了一种新型的多功能电流模式二阶滤波器电路。该电路基于多端输出电流控制第二代电流传输器,仅需2个MOCCC-II和2个电容,无需元件匹配就能同时实现低通、带通、高通、带阻及全通滤波输出。电路中所有的无源元件均接地,且参数敏感度低。该滤波器可用于通信、电子测量与仪器仪表的信号处理。PSpice仿真结果与理论分析相吻合,验证了该方法的可行性。

A Multi-function Current-mode Filter Based on MOCCC-II

Abstract:This paper presents a multi-function current-mode second-order filter based on current contro,eu second generation current conveyor with multiple outputs. The filter is composed of two MOCCC-IIs and two capacitors which can realize low-pass, band-pass, high-pass, band-stop and all-pass filtering outputs at the same time without elements match. All the RC elements are grounded, and the sensitivities of the circuit are very low. The filter can be applied to signal processes for communication, electronic measure and instrument. PSpice simulation results tallies with the theoretical analysis, which proves that this method is practical
